
Hard to believe that Dubai, now a major tourist destination and one of the major players in the global economy, was less than a century ago little more than a desert wasteland, home to Bedouin and a group of settlers around the creek, a natural inlet of sea water that currently occupies the center of the city. At the time when Europe was embarking on WWI, Dubai still had no running water or roads and the main means of transportation was still the camel.
Dubai is a sprawling city where walking is difficult and in which there are no marked trails for tourists. However, one of the best ways to discover the charms of the city is to walk through the oldest parts of Deira and Bur Dubai, its traditional souks, mosques and wind towers hidden. Arabian Adventures offers the course “A Walk through the City of Contrasts” on Mondays, Wednesdays and Fridays from October to April. This course covers the areas of Bastakiya, the souks of spices and gold and includes a ride through the open bay leaving from Shindagha.
Several companies offer tours of the city for half day, including Arabian Adventures and Net Tours Dubai. Tours vary depending on the operator, but most go through the souks of old and new Dubai, the Jumeirah Mosque and the thriving business area. They also usually include a creek crossing in open or water taxi. Rates start from 120AED. Another option is to visit Dubai at night. The night tours usually include dinner at a restaurant and include visits to mosques, palaces and souks. The tours operate a very organized, collected at major Dubai hotels.
